Thanks, We were booked on the 14 night Alaska itinerary on the Infinity for this August when this cruise was canceled and turned into a 9 night Pacific coastal cruise due to 5 nights being chartered by Dreamforce. We also found out about this on cruisecritic and were later given a call from Celebrity informing us of the same. They did notify us nearly a year ahead of time but were offering very little in the way of compensation. They gave us a list of cruises we could chose from for the same price that we had booked the Alaska cruise under ... but the rep I spoke with explained it had to be in the exact same category. We were also offered $200 onboard credit, which was fair....not particularly generous but fair. Your new cruise had to be booked within a short time period....maybe it was a couple of weeks. Since I really liked the SF roundtrip itinerary, I wanted to book the California Coastal itinerary instead, which was on the list of the available cruises to choose from but whomever was assigned to handle my reservation was a real lulu and I was only offered the same pricing as the 14 night Alaskan cruise, which I wasn't willing to pay seeing it was over $4000 for an oceanview room for a nine night coastal. I couldn't get over how apathetic the rep was....so took my chances and called back later to talk to someone else. They wouldn't release the new pricing until beyond the deadline to switch the reservation to a different cruise. It was frustrating at the time but I did end up getting a much more knowledgeable rep at Celebrity and ended up getting a decent deal, albeit an inside cabin, on the Coastal cruise. As mentioned, the only thing we really got for them cancelling our Alaska cruise was the $200 but since the air schedules weren't open for booking at that time, I guess nobody was really out a lot of money, much less us who don't have to fly. The only thing we were really out was a lot of time in planning the original trip. So, if $200 doesn't sound like sufficient compensation, you may want to have alternate plans in mind.
